Frustrated Ohioans Haven’t Given Up on GOP

See full Cleveland Plain Dealer article

While the survey results suggest America’s bellwether state might be turning against Republican leadership, don’t paint Ohio blue just yet. Ohio voters — often a barometer of the national mood — still look to the GOP to guide them on national security, immigration and taxes, issues already getting plenty of attention in the presidential campaign.
